项目实战 10.3 开发环境搭建教程
在进行HTML5项目开发之前,搭建一个合适的开发环境是至关重要的。一个良好的开发环境不仅能提高开发效率,还能减少调试和测试的时间。本文将详细介绍如何搭建一个HTML5开发环境,包括所需工具、配置步骤、优缺点及注意事项。
1. 开发环境概述
在搭建开发环境之前,我们需要明确开发环境的组成部分。一个完整的HTML5开发环境通常包括以下几个部分:
- 代码编辑器:用于编写和编辑代码。
- 本地服务器:用于运行和测试HTML5应用。
- 版本控制系统:用于管理代码版本。
- 浏览器:用于查看和调试应用。
2. 选择代码编辑器
2.1 推荐编辑器
- Visual Studio Code (VS Code)
- Sublime Text
- Atom
2.2 示例:使用VS Code
安装步骤
- 访问 Visual Studio Code官网。
- 下载适合您操作系统的安装包。
- 按照安装向导完成安装。
优点
- 强大的扩展性:支持多种插件,增强功能。
- 内置终端:方便运行命令。
- 智能提示:代码补全和错误提示。
缺点
- 资源占用:相对较重,可能在低配置机器上运行不流畅。
- 学习曲线:对于新手来说,功能较多,可能需要时间适应。
注意事项
- 定期更新VS Code及其插件,以获得最新功能和修复。
3. 本地服务器搭建
3.1 推荐服务器
- Node.js + Express
- http-server
- Live Server (VS Code插件)
3.2 示例:使用http-server
安装步骤
-
确保已安装Node.js。可以在 Node.js官网 下载并安装。
-
打开终端,运行以下命令安装http-server:
npm install -g http-server
-
在项目目录下启动服务器:
http-server
优点
- 简单易用:只需一条命令即可启动。
- 支持热重载:修改文件后自动刷新浏览器。
缺点
- 功能有限:不适合复杂的后端需求。
- 安全性:默认配置不适合生产环境。
注意事项
- 确保在开发环境中使用,避免在生产环境中使用http-server。
4. 版本控制系统
4.1 推荐工具
- Git
- GitHub/GitLab/Bitbucket(远程仓库)
4.2 示例:使用Git
安装步骤
-
访问 Git官网 下载并安装。
-
配置Git用户信息:
git config --global user.name "Your Name" git config --global user.email "you@example.com"
优点
- 版本管理:可以轻松回退到之前的版本。
- 协作开发:支持多人协作,合并代码。
缺点
- 学习曲线:对于新手来说,命令行操作可能较为复杂。
- 冲突处理:多人协作时可能会出现代码冲突。
注意事项
- 定期提交代码,保持良好的提交习惯。
5. 浏览器选择
5.1 推荐浏览器
- Google Chrome
- Mozilla Firefox
- Microsoft Edge
5.2 示例:使用Chrome开发者工具
优点
- 强大的调试功能:可以实时查看和修改HTML、CSS和JavaScript。
- 丰富的扩展:支持多种开发者工具和插件。
缺点
- 资源占用:Chrome在某些情况下可能占用较多内存。
- 隐私问题:部分用户对Google的隐私政策有所顾虑。
注意事项
- 定期更新浏览器,以确保使用最新的开发者工具。
6. 总结
搭建一个高效的HTML5开发环境是成功开发项目的基础。通过选择合适的代码编辑器、本地服务器、版本控制系统和浏览器,您可以大大提高开发效率和代码质量。在搭建过程中,注意各个工具的优缺点及使用注意事项,以便更好地适应开发需求。
希望本教程能帮助您顺利搭建HTML5开发环境,开启您的开发之旅!